SAN ANTONIO (WBAP/KLIF News) – A federal judge has sided with a civil rights group that claimed that Texas is in violation of national voter registration laws.
U.S. District Judge Orlando Garcia of San Antonio ordered a fix that could launch the state’s first online voter registration system.
In 2016, The Texas Civil Rights Project filed the lawsuit on behalf of four Texans who claimed they were unable to participate in recent elections because their voter registration had not been updated.
The group said Texas violated federal law by failing to register residents to vote when they updated their drivers’ license information online.
More details on how the Garcia will direct Texas to comply are expected in the next two weeks.
An appeal of the ruling is expected.
